What Is the Smallest (AI) Platform That Could Possibly Work? At Vipps, one of the most common requests I see is access to LLMs. Giving an engineer an API key is easy. It solves the immediate access problem. However, it doesn’t show finance which team created the cost, help compliance understand where the data goes, or give incident response a way to observe the system. There is always additional work that often comes later, sometimes weeks after the main work. So, when does recurring work justify a platform used by several teams? And if it does, what is the smallest platform that could possibly work? I am using AI agents as the current case. By agents, I mean software built with LLMs, skills, and integrations with internal or external tools.
